This document outlines the syllabus for the course CS54119 Information Security taught by Dr. Udai Pratap Rao at NIT Patna. The course focuses on fundamentals of information security, including principles of confidentiality, integrity and availability. It covers topics such as cryptography, authentication methods, software security, ethics and hacking. The syllabus is divided into 7 units covering areas such as security principles, cryptography, risk management, threats and vulnerabilities. Assessment is based on identifying appropriate security technologies, developing security policies, and applying encryption techniques.